      The homebank Portfile 57375 2009-09-10 08:16:41Z ryandesign macports.org $

      PortSystem 1.0

      Name: homebank
      Version: 4.0.3
      Category: x11
      Platform: darwin
      Maintainers: simon openmaintainer
      Description: Software to manage personal accounts, light and simple.
      Long Description: HomeBank is the free software you have always wanted to manage your personal accounts at home. The main concept is to be light, simple and very easy to use. It brings you many features that allow you to analyze your finances in a detailed way instantly and dynamically with powerful report tools based on filtering and graphical charts.

      Homepage: http://homebank.free.fr/
      Master Sites: ${homepage}public/

      Checksums: md5 8ff3dde0a594f34d086148e4bae2d624 sha1 6ac0dfebabacdca3f3dc4b9369b1ff5a6f2e1a03 rmd160 e3101069dcafe59a93ff960e0150f139e3893821

      depends_lib port:gtk2 port:libofx port:librsvg port:p5-xml-parser

      livecheck.type regex
      livecheck.regex "HomeBank (\\d+(?:\\.\\d+)*) released"

    If you haven't already installed Darwin Ports, you can find easy instructions for doing so at the main Darwin Ports page.

    Once Darwin Ports has been installed, in a terminal window and while online, type the following and hit return:


      %  cd /opt/local/bin/portslocation/dports/homebank
      % sudo port install homebank
      Password:
    You will then be prompted for your root password, which you should enter. You may have to wait for a few minutes while the software is retrieved from the network and installed for you. Y ou should see something that looks similar to:

      ---> Fetching homebank
      ---> Verifying checksum for homebank
      ---> Extracting homebank
      ---> Configuring homebank
      ---> Building homebank with target all
      ---> Staging homebank into destroot
      ---> Installing homebank
    - Make sure that you do not close the terminal window while Darwin Ports is working. Once the software has been installed, you can find further information about using homebank with these commands:
      %  man homebank
      % apropos homebank
      % which homebank
      % locate homebank
